Light-Consuming Darkness is a Pokemon Trading Card Game set, part of the Sun & Moon Series series, released on June 16, 2017, containing 64 cards.
When was Light-Consuming Darkness released?
The Light-Consuming Darkness Pokemon TCG set was released on June 16, 2017.
How many cards are in the Light-Consuming Darkness set?
There are 64 base cards in the Light-Consuming Darkness set. This count reflects the standard set list; some cards may have alternate printings or variants such as reverse holofoil, master ball, poke ball, prize pack, or stamped versions.
What rarities are in the Light-Consuming Darkness set?
The Light-Consuming Darkness set includes the following rarities: Common (25), Uncommon (16), Rare (6), Secret Rare (6), Double Rare (4), Hyper Rare (4), and Ultra Rare (3).
